MURAKAMI, TAKASHI
One Plate, from We Are The Square Jocular Clan
Stock Code 108308
2018
£1,250
© Takashi Murakami/Kaikai Kiki Co., Ltd. All Rights Reserved
Offset lithograph in colours, 2018, on wove paper, signed in ink and numbered from the edition of 300, published by Kaikai Kiki Co., Ltd., Tokyo, 47.5 x 47.5 cm. (18 3/4 x 18 3/4 in.) -
